Prem, can be compared to the Head Of Concierge. He provided us with the information of all the places to visit in and around Madikeri. Since, I was travelling with 3 senior citizens the most experienced being of 78 years , Prem's suggestions of can do & cannot do the following places came in handy.
He knew that I was interested to try out all the possible items of local cuisine. He suggested us a eatery( COORG CUISINETTE) for authentic local Coorg cuisine. We had Pandi curry, chicken pepper fry, Mutton pepper fry,nool puttu, kadambuttu .
It was fiery but excellent!!!
We had travelled all the way from Goa, by road. Unfortunately, I had missed a turn and had to do 72 kms extra. Because of the terrain this small mistake prooved to be very costly and we had to be on the road for 3 hours extra.
Prem, kept this in mind and was kind enough to provide us with a road map on our way back. It prooved to be a better route and lesser by 68 kms.
Route taken was..Madikeri---puttur---Sulia---mangalore--murudeshwar--karwar---Goa.
Overall it was an excellent stay. We were 7 adults and a kid and did not have any problem whatsoever in our stay. It was quiet comfortable and not hot as expected by us, as it was end of May.
We went to Dubare Elephant camp, Thalacauvery, to a coffee plantation, Nisargadham island,Kushalnagar Monastery( worth a visit)
On our way back we tried out the famous ghee roast in Shetty Lunch Home, Kundapur
